Sketchbook Project – Cedar Bark
Pages Thirteen and Fourteen: I chose three ways to show the texture of Cedar bark, a photo, a rubbing of the tree trunk and a scratchboard sketch of the pattern. All the tree trunks featured in the book are from … Continue reading
